Paper 2 · Reaction Kinetics

When [H2]=[NO]=1 moldm3[H_2] = [NO] = 1\ mol\,dm^{-3} the rate is 0.024 moldm3s10.024\ mol\,dm^{-3}\,s^{-1} and rate =k[H2][NO]2= k[H_2][NO]^2. The rate constant is

A0.024 s10.024\ s^{-1}
B0.024 mol1dm3s10.024\ mol^{-1}dm^3s^{-1}
C0.024 moldm3s10.024\ mol\,dm^{-3}s^{-1}
D0.024 mol2dm6s10.024\ mol^{-2}dm^6s^{-1}
Explanation: For an overall third order reaction the units of kk are mol2dm6s1mol^{-2}dm^6s^{-1}.
